Output 990d2b0543c30994558085fd5db34a1e95dcc52feb588bf265f21ceaec33318f:0

value
2250000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18629c3a98fbf9b886f62986f00a827c43152019 OP_EQUALVERIFY OP_CHECKSIG
address
13DwMAbtpvJr5BPCDbpxj53bciu4ebUhjK
transaction
990d2b0543c30994558085fd5db34a1e95dcc52feb588bf265f21ceaec33318f
spent
true